No, with the right person you will have chemistry. Things just click. Example. My now ex wife and I , when we met I did not look at her and think she was the most beautiful or sexiest woman I had ever dated at all. At the same time she was pretty but she also was a geek in a way to me. She was the book reading type that was smart intelligent, she didn't dress provocative by any means, she wore very little make up.. she was not the glamour girl type I had normally dated. But I met her at work... and as time went by I found myself drawn to her, she had this amazing sense of humor. She was always making me laugh and she had this beautiful smile that to me when she smiled she suddenly wasn't the short little nerd woman at work but I seen her in a different light as the old song used to say. One day we were cutting up at work and I just asked her out. She instantly turned red blushing and said ok. Well a few days later I took her out to eat and to a movie, when I drove her back home, we had our first kiss... that kiss was different than the average kiss I was used to with other women. It was the kind of kiss that you knew you had chemistry... time stood still so to speak and you get this tingly feeling as if electricity is almost making the hair stand up on your arm. I knew she was different that first kiss. I later found out she felt the same way and it was why she said she reached up as that first kiss ended and grabbed me to kiss once more. The next day that I had a few min. Alone with her at work, I remember I told her I wanted to see her without her glasses. She blushed again but I took her glasses off. She had always had beautiful hazel eyes, but I had never seen them without the frames in front of them. Anyway we always had high level chemistry which led to a very high level of physical attraction later and even though we were opposites in most every way as far as hobbies and interest, we made it work and we're very happy for a long time. We stayed married 12 years. We divorced over our differences finally though. We had different dreams and ambitions that were putting a strain on our marriage, when together we still had the chemistry, we still do honestly. We live 6 states away from each other now, but we talk often, we remain friends, we text and sometimes call each other. When on the phone she still makes me laugh, the weirdest thing is both of us moved on ended up with other people then both ended up single again, and we joke at times about we should have just stayed married, at least half joking. I am positive if we got together just to hang out even now the chemistry the laughing and all would still be there, it always was. Also just so you know chemistry by that I'm not meaning sex, though we never had a problem there and for the first few years we were married we almost at times seemed to do little else. But chemistry is not just attraction physically at all... chemistry is when you just their good, their bad, it doesn't matter, you just know they make you happy, they make you feel better than normal when they are around and they feel that way also. Not just physical now. I am meaning even if your just sitting talking, just eating, just in the car together going shopping, no matter what it is, that person makes everything better just by being there and you can't get enough time together. That's chemistry if you both have it. It's not the easiest thing to find but you for sure know it when it hits you.
